Overview
Medama Analytics is an open-source project dedicated to providing self-hostable, cookie-free website analytics. With a lightweight tracker of less than 1KB, it aims to offer useful analytics while prioritising user privacy.<a href="https://demo.medama.io" target="_blank">
<img src="https://raw.githubusercontent.com/medama-io/medama/HEAD/.github/images/demo.png" alt="Demo Screenshot" width="70%" height="70%">
</a>Features
- 📊 Real-Time Analytics: Monitor website performance and user interactions instantly.
- 🔒 Privacy-Focused: Lightweight tracker (<1KB) without cookies, IP addresses, or additional identifiers, ensuring compliance with GDPR, PECR, and other regulations.
- 🧪 Easy To Integrate: OpenAPI-based server for effortless integration into personal or professional dashboards.
- 💼 Self-Hostable: Simple, single-binary setup with no external dependencies, capable of running on VMs with 256MB memory for most small websites.

}Check the logs first
Nine times out of ten the logs tell you exactly what went wrong.
- In Portainer, go to Containers, click the container, then Logs. Or run
docker logs <container> - Exit codes help too:
137means killed, usually out of memory.126or127means the command inside the image is broken.
Port already in use
If deployment fails with "Bind for 0.0.0.0:8010 failed: port is already allocated", something else on your server is using that port.
- Find what's using it:
sudo ss -tlnp | grep :8010 - Stop the other service, or pick a different host port. In
8010:8080only the left number is yours to change, the right one belongs to the app.
Running but the page won't load
The container is up but nothing appears in your browser.
- Use your server's real IP:
http://your-server-ip:8010. The 0.0.0.0 link Portainer shows isn't a real address. - Give it a minute after first deploy, medama can take a while to initialise.
- Make sure your firewall allows the port, e.g.
sudo ufw allow 8010
Permission denied on volumes
If the logs show "permission denied", the app can't write to its data folder on the host.
- Fix the ownership:
sudo chown -R 1000:1000 /portainer/Files/AppData/Config/medama
Image won't pull
Test the pull directly on the host: docker pull ghcr.io/medama-io/medama:latest
- "manifest unknown" means the tag no longer exists. This template uses
latest, so try pinning a specific version instead. - "toomanyrequests" is the Docker Hub rate limit. Log in with
docker loginto raise it. - "no space left on device" means a full disk. Reclaim space with
docker system prune
"exec format error"
This means the image was built for a different CPU architecture than your server.
- This image supports:
amd64, arm64 - Check yours with
uname -m: x86_64 is amd64, aarch64 is arm64. Raspberry Pi and other ARM boards are the usual culprits.
Stack won't deploy
Compose stacks fail fast on small mistakes, and Portainer shows the reason just above the editor.
- YAML only accepts spaces for indentation, a single tab breaks the whole file.

A Compose stack
Medama is a Compose stack, a set of containers defined in one file and brought up together by Portainer, then started and stopped as a single app.
The app image
An image is the app packed up ready to go, everything Medama needs bundled into one download. This template pulls ghcr.io/medama-io/medama:latest, which Docker fetches once (about 37 MB) and then starts your own copy from.
Where the image comes from
Docker pulls its images from registries, public libraries of ready-built apps. Medama's comes from the GitHub Container Registry, published by medama-io.
Version tags
The bit after the colon in the image name is the version tag. Here it's latest, which always points at the newest build, so a redeploy can bump you to a newer release without you asking. Pin a specific tag if you would rather stay on one version.
Which machines it runs on
Every image is built for particular CPU types. This one ships for amd64, arm64, so it runs on both regular x86 servers and ARM boards like a Raspberry Pi.
Ports
A port is the door the app answers on. A mapping like 8010:8080 means it's reachable on port 8010 of your server, where the left number is yours to change and the right one belongs to the app. Once it's running, open http://your-server-ip:8010 in a browser. It opens:
8010:8080, likely the web interface
Volumes
A volume is where Medama keeps its files so they survive an update or a restart. Without one, anything it saves would sit inside the container and vanish the moment it's recreated. This template mounts:
/app/datafrom/portainer/Files/AppData/Config/medamaon the host
Networking
Nothing custom is set, so Medama sits on Docker's default bridge network: its own private space that reaches the outside world only through the ports it publishes.
Container name
Once it's deployed, Portainer names the container medama. That's what you'll spot in the containers list and use in commands like docker logs medama.
